.page-wrapper.svelte-13864x3{width:100%;height:100%;display:flex;align-items:center;justify-content:center}.select-screen.svelte-13864x3{display:flex;flex-direction:column;align-items:center;gap:12px;padding:16px 0}.page-title.svelte-13864x3{font-family:"Press Start 2P",monospace;font-size:24px;color:var(--color-snes-accent-success);text-align:center;text-shadow:3px 3px 0 #000}.page-subtitle.svelte-13864x3{font-family:"Press Start 2P",monospace;font-size:12px;color:var(--color-snes-text-main);opacity:.7}.archetypes-grid.svelte-13864x3{display:grid;grid-template-columns:repeat(3,1fr);gap:16px;width:100%;margin:12px 0}.archetype-card.svelte-13864x3{background:#000;border:4px solid var(--color-snes-grey);padding:12px 16px;display:flex;flex-direction:column;align-items:center;gap:8px;cursor:pointer;transition:all .2s;position:relative}.archetype-card.svelte-13864x3:hover{transform:translateY(-4px)}.archetype-card.selected.svelte-13864x3{border-width:4px}.archetype-card.stan.selected.svelte-13864x3{border-color:var(--color-stan-primary);box-shadow:0 0 20px #ff6b9d66}.archetype-card.tech.selected.svelte-13864x3{border-color:var(--color-tech-primary);box-shadow:0 0 20px #00d4ff66}.archetype-card.edgy.selected.svelte-13864x3{border-color:var(--color-edgy-primary);box-shadow:0 0 20px #9b59b666}.selected-badge.svelte-13864x3{position:absolute;top:8px;right:8px;font-family:"Press Start 2P",monospace;font-size:12px;color:var(--color-snes-accent-success)}.archetype-sprite.svelte-13864x3{width:256px;height:256px;display:flex;align-items:center;justify-content:center}.archetype-name.svelte-13864x3{font-family:"Press Start 2P",monospace;font-size:14px;color:#fff}.archetype-buff.svelte-13864x3{font-family:"Press Start 2P",monospace;font-size:9px;color:var(--color-snes-text-main);opacity:.7;text-align:center;line-height:1.5}.action-section.svelte-13864x3{margin-top:4px}.info-text.svelte-13864x3{font-family:"Press Start 2P",monospace;font-size:8px;color:var(--color-snes-text-main);opacity:.5}@media(max-width:900px){.archetypes-grid.svelte-13864x3{grid-template-columns:1fr;max-width:280px}.archetype-sprite.svelte-13864x3{width:150px;height:150px}.page-title.svelte-13864x3{font-size:16px}.archetype-name.svelte-13864x3{font-size:12px}.archetype-buff.svelte-13864x3{font-size:8px}}
